Ludo is a easy pastime for all ages that is based on an ancient Indian contest called Pachisi. The objective is to transport all four of your tokens from your home area to the final square, observing the rules of the die . You'll throw a normal dice to determine your progress , and landing on another person's square will send them home . Enjoy the pleasure of this well-known social game !
The History and The Development
Ludo, the simple game , boasts an fascinating history that dates back many years . While commonly connected with India, ludo's beginnings can are found to an ancient Indian game called Pachisi, played as early during the 6th era AD. Pachisi, which, was derived the Persian game of Chaturanga, which shaped chess. With the years , Pachisi became an important recreational activity in the Mughal court . The Europeans , upon finding Pachisi in India, changed it as a form better appropriate to Western inclinations. This simplified game, originally called Ludo, started appearing in England near 1896, then rapidly attracted recognition globally . Today, contemporary Ludo retains most of the fundamental features of its origins while presenting an fun experience for people of all ages .

Ludo Tips and Tricks
{To improve your odds of success in Ludo, employ these simple methods. Prioritize getting your pawns out of the base as fast as possible . Always keep an eye on your rivals' advancement and seek to hinder them whenever possible . Clever dice usage isn’t completely attainable , but understanding the probabilities can assist you make smarter choices . Finally, don't forget that luck plays a role , so remain composed and enjoy the play !

Ludo Variations: Exploring Different Rule Sets
While the standard Ludo board game is widely recognized , a remarkable array of versions exist, each with unique system sets. Some adaptations might prioritize speed, demanding players to advance their pieces with increased speed. Others incorporate new elements , like punishment spaces or the option to steal an opponent’s piece. These diverse approaches to Ludo offer a wealth of engaging ways to participate in this beloved childhood game .
